(See "Five Signs You would certainly Be A Terrific Therapist") Why do specialists invest a lot time recognizing themselves? Due to the fact that treatment sessions are often psychological rollercoaster experiences. When specialists understand their background and sensations, they have a security belt on that particular rollercoaster and have the ability to stay focused in sessions.


These feelings most generally derive from a patient's history. As an example, an individual with a background of psychological abuse or disregard will have problem trusting the specialist. Or an individual that had a traumaticchildhood years will certainly keep the specialist at a distance or appear cool or removed - dissociative identity disorder treatments. Transfer feelings in session are typically forecasts from patients' histories.

Goal countertransference describes the therapist's sensations toward the patient based on the specialist's feedback to the person's transference. If a patient doesn't rely on the therapist, an inadequately trained or brand-new therapist might take it directly and encourage the individual to trust them. This often backfires and intensifies resistance to trust fund.




 
(https://www.behance.net/barryturner1)Transfer Essential Reads Like unbiased countertransference, subjective countertransference also describes the specialist's sensations towards the person. However those certain feelings derive from the therapist's personal history. For instance, if the therapist has a childhood history of abuse, a violent patient might activate the specialist's trauma. The specialist may hesitate of the person.




They might find a method to stop working with the person or stay clear of facing them out of anxiety of revenge. In specific sessions, therapists navigate the 3 degrees of feelings - transference, countertransference, and subjective transference - by regularly refining and assessing their feelings. "Where is this feeling originating from? Is it the patient's transfer? Or is it my subjective or objective countertransference?" Team therapists handle numerous transfers.

As a whole, the term "therapist" is all-inclusive and describes psychologists, psychotherapists and therapists. When describing a specialist that works with a client to boost his or her psychological wellness, specialist and therapist might be used interchangeably.


A counselor frequently has a bit much less education and learning or training but is still required to be certified to exercise. A therapist may specialize in a specific area, such as marital relationship counselling, to offer those looking to enhance their marital or familial relationships. A therapist may have a higher degree of education than a counselor, maybe even a doctorate level.
